Transaction f34a95d3250d49f9ba0da5c58ee965674336cac2a29121a170137581b105142a

2 Input
2 Outputs
  • f34a95d3250d49f9ba0da5c58ee965674336cac2a29121a170137581b105142a:0
  • value  6974693
    address  3EhfpKmBcpVJqH1XKxMs3mmJS7FdVVkMLe
  • f34a95d3250d49f9ba0da5c58ee965674336cac2a29121a170137581b105142a:1
  • value  3764
    address  3BMEX1JByFEm6WeBXuhkZ5zEVytfRB3pBq